Wood Cabinet Staining in Carmel, IN
Wood cabinet staining services involve applying a durable finish to enhance the appearance and protect the wood surfaces of cabinets in kitchens, bathrooms, and other areas. This service is suitable for a variety of projects, including updating existing cabinets, restoring worn finishes, or changing the color to better match interior decor. Homeowners typically seek cabinet staining to achieve a richer, more polished look or to refresh the style of their space without replacing the cabinetry entirely.
Before requesting wood cabinet staining, property owners should consider the current condition of the cabinets, including any existing finishes, damage, or wear. It’s also important to determine the desired color or stain type, as well as whether any surface preparation, such as cleaning or sanding, is necessary. Understanding the scope of the project and the preferred finish can help ensure the results meet expectations and complement the overall aesthetic of the property.

Wood Cabinet Staining Questions
What types of cabinets can be stained? Wood cabinet staining is suitable for most types of wooden cabinets, including kitchen, bathroom, and furniture pieces.
Will staining change the color of my cabinets? Yes, staining enhances the natural wood grain and can add a variety of color tones based on the stain selected.
Is staining a good option for old or damaged cabinets? Staining can improve the appearance of older cabinets and help conceal minor imperfections, providing a refreshed look.
How should I prepare my cabinets for staining? Cabinets should be cleaned thoroughly and sanded lightly to ensure proper stain adhesion and a smooth finish.
